Vent leak repair services focus on identifying and sealing leaks within a building’s ventilation and exhaust systems. Over time, vents can develop small cracks, gaps, or deteriorate due to age, weather, or improper installation. Skilled service providers use specialized tools and techniques to locate these leaks accurately and then seal them effectively. Proper vent sealing not only improves indoor air quality but also helps prevent unwanted airflow that can lead to energy waste and increased utility bills.
These services are essential for solving common problems such as drafts, musty odors, and inconsistent indoor temperatures. When vents or exhaust systems are compromised, they can allow outdoor air, moisture, or pests to enter the property. This can cause discomfort and may contribute to issues like mold growth or increased heating and cooling costs. The overview below groups typical Vent Leak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sugar Grove,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or vent leak repairs in Sugar Grove, IL, range from $250 to $600. Most routine jobs fall within this range, covering small leaks or sealant fixes on individual vents.
Moderate Repairs - More involved repairs, such as replacing sections of ductwork or sealing multiple vents, generally cost between $600 and $1,500. Many projects in this category are completed within this range, depending on the scope.
Full Vent System Replacement - Complete replacement of a vent system or extensive ductwork can range from $2,000 to $5,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ects tend to reach the higher end of this spectrum, but fewer jobs fall into this tier.
Emergency or Complex Jobs - Emergency repairs or highly complex projects, such as dealing with extensive damage or inaccessible areas, can exceed $5,000. These cases are less common but can significantly vary based on specific circumstances and system size.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es vent leaks in a home? Vent leaks can occur due to damaged or deteriorated vent pipes, loose fittings, or improper installation, allowing air or gases to escape from the vent system.
How can I tell if my vent system has a leak? Signs of a vent leak include unusual odors, increased energy bills, or visible damage to vent pipes. A professional inspection can accurately identify leaks.
What types of services do local contractors offer for vent leak repair? Local service providers typically perform leak detection, pipe sealing, and replacement of damaged vent components to restore proper function.
Are vent leaks dangerous for my home? Yes, vent leaks can lead to the escape of harmful gases or moisture, which may cause indoor air quality issues or structural damage if left unaddressed.
